一、jquery对象数组
jquery对象是由类似数组的对象组成的。它们可以存储多个DOM元素,并提供多种用于操纵DOM元素的方法。
下面是jquery对象数组的示例:
var elements = $('p'); //选择所有的p元素 console.log(elements.length); //输出p元素的数量
上述代码中,$是jquery库的实例化对象,它的作用是选择所有的p元素,并将它们存储到elements变量中。然后就可以通过调用elements变量的方法来操纵这些元素。
二、jquery对象完整html
jquery对象提供了一个用于获取或设置元素完整HTML结构的方法。
下面是获取元素完整HTML结构的示例:
var html = $('p').html(); //获取第一个p元素的完整HTML结构 console.log(html); //输出获取的HTML结构
上述代码中,html方法用于获取第一个p元素的完整HTML结构,并将结果存储到html变量中。然后就可以通过调用html变量来访问这个HTML结构。
下面是设置元素完整HTML结构的示例:
$('p').html('Hello World'); //将第一个p元素的HTML结构设置为Hello World
上述代码中,html方法用于将第一个p元素的HTML结构设置为Hello World。
三、jquery对象是事件吗
jquery对象不是事件。然而,jquery对象可以绑定到事件处理程序上进行事件处理。
下面是绑定jquery对象到事件处理程序的示例:
$('p').click(function() { console.log('Paragraph clicked'); });
上述代码中,click方法用于将点击事件绑定到所有的p元素上,并在点击时输出一条信息到控制台。
四、jquery对象和dom对象区别
jquery对象和DOM对象最大的区别是它们的方法不同。DOM对象只能使用原生的JavaScript DOM方法,而jquery对象可以使用丰富的jquery方法。
下面是获取DOM对象和jquery对象的示例:
var domElement = document.getElementById('myElement'); //获取DOM元素 var jqueryElement = $('#myElement'); //获取jquery元素
上述代码中,getElementById方法用于获取一个DOM元素,而$方法用于获取一个jquery元素。
五、jquery对象打印方法
jquery对象提供了一个用于打印jquery对象内容的方法。
下面是打印jquery对象的示例:
var elements = $('p'); //选择所有的p元素 console.log(elements); //直接输出jquery对象
上述代码中,console.log方法用于将jquery对象输出到控制台。注意,这种输出方法不会输出HTML结构,只会输出jquery对象。
六、jquery对象和dom对象的说法正确
jquery对象是DOM对象的一个包装。因此,可以将jquery对象转换为DOM对象进行操作。
下面是将jquery对象转换为DOM对象的示例:
var elements = $('p'); //选择所有的p元素 var domElement = elements[0]; //将第一个p元素转换为DOM元素 console.log(domElement); //输出DOM元素
上述代码中,[0]表示获取jquery对象中的第一个元素,并将其转换为DOM元素。然后,使用console.log将DOM元素输出到控制台。
七、jquery对象array
jquery对象可以转换为数组。这可以让开发人员使用原生的JavaScript方法来操作jquery对象。
下面是将jquery对象转换为数组的示例:
var elements = $('p'); //选择所有的p元素 var array = $.makeArray(elements); //将jquery对象转换为数组 console.log(array.length); //输出数组的长度
上述代码中,makeArray方法用于将jquery对象转换为数组,并将结果存储到array变量中。然后可以使用原生的JavaScript数组方法来操作这个array变量。
八、jquery对象和dom对象转换
可以将jquery对象转换为DOM对象,也可以将DOM对象转换为jquery对象。
下面是将jquery对象转换为DOM对象的示例:
var elements = $('p'); //选择所有的p元素 var domElement = elements[0]; //将第一个p元素转换为DOM元素
下面是将DOM对象转换为jquery对象的示例:
var element = document.getElementById('myElement'); //获取DOM元素 var jqueryElement = $(element); //将DOM元素转换为jquery对象
上述代码中,getElementById方法用于获取DOM元素,并将其转换为jquery对象。
九、jquery对象的元素移除类
jquery对象提供了一个用于移除元素的类的方法。
下面是移除jquery对象元素类的示例:
var elements = $('p'); //选择所有的p元素 elements.removeClass('active'); //移除所有p元素的active类
上述代码中,removeClass方法用于移除所有p元素的active类。